Transaction 5829810c6d90cbf8d6be6085f202d7dc1367c2c351581c1d9b3f897dead8c561
1 Input
1 Output
-
5829810c6d90cbf8d6be6085f202d7dc1367c2c351581c1d9b3f897dead8c561:0
- value
- 444791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e774225b5ba2d23a9be94f07011243e1e8db79 OP_EQUAL
- address
- 39A5vmEfJJ931Zyf75b4zb9SQAtox6By63